1.1 root 1: /*
2: * minimal definitions of 4BSD `fast file system' format
3: * just enough to read a disk volume
4: */
5:
6: #define SBLOCK 8192 /* byte offset to (first) super-block */
7: #define SBSIZE 8192 /* size of super-block */
8:
9: /*
10: * contents of super-block
11: */
12:
13: struct fs
14: {
15: struct fs *fs_link; /* linked list of file systems */
16: struct fs *fs_rlink; /* used for incore super blocks */
17: long fs_sblkno; /* addr of super-block in filesys */
18: long fs_cblkno; /* offset of cyl-block in filesys */
19: long fs_iblkno; /* offset of inode-blocks in filesys */
20: long fs_dblkno; /* offset of first data after cg */
21: long fs_cgoffset; /* cylinder group offset in cylinder */
22: long fs_cgmask; /* used to calc mod fs_ntrak */
23: long fs_time; /* last time written */
24: long fs_size; /* number of blocks in fs */
25: long fs_dsize; /* number of data blocks in fs */
26: long fs_ncg; /* number of cylinder groups */
27: long fs_bsize; /* size of basic blocks in fs */
28: long fs_fsize; /* size of frag blocks in fs */
29: long fs_frag; /* number of frags in a block in fs */
30: /* these are configuration parameters */
31: long fs_minfree; /* minimum percentage of free blocks */
32: long fs_rotdelay; /* num of ms for optimal next block */
33: long fs_rps; /* disk revolutions per second */
34: /* these fields can be computed from the others */
35: long fs_bmask; /* ``blkoff'' calc of blk offsets */
36: long fs_fmask; /* ``fragoff'' calc of frag offsets */
37: long fs_bshift; /* ``lblkno'' calc of logical blkno */
38: long fs_fshift; /* ``numfrags'' calc number of frags */
39: /* these are configuration parameters */
40: long fs_maxcontig; /* max number of contiguous blks */
41: long fs_maxbpg; /* max number of blks per cyl group */
42: /* these fields can be computed from the others */
43: long fs_fragshift; /* block to frag shift */
44: long fs_fsbtodb; /* fsbtodb and dbtofsb shift constant */
45: long fs_sbsize; /* actual size of super block */
46: long fs_csmask; /* csum block offset */
47: long fs_csshift; /* csum block number */
48: long fs_nindir; /* value of NINDIR */
49: long fs_inopb; /* value of INOPB */
50: long fs_nspf; /* value of NSPF */
51: long fs_optim; /* optimization preference, see below */
52: long fs_sparecon[5]; /* reserved for future constants */
53: /* sizes determined by number of cylinder groups and their sizes */
54: long fs_csaddr; /* blk addr of cyl grp summary area */
55: long fs_cssize; /* size of cyl grp summary area */
56: long fs_cgsize; /* cylinder group size */
57: /* these fields should be derived from the hardware */
58: long fs_ntrak; /* tracks per cylinder */
59: long fs_nsect; /* sectors per track */
60: long fs_spc; /* sectors per cylinder */
61: /* this comes from the disk driver partitioning */
62: long fs_ncyl; /* cylinders in file system */
63: /* these fields can be computed from the others */
64: long fs_cpg; /* cylinders per group */
65: long fs_ipg; /* inodes per group */
66: long fs_fpg; /* blocks per group * fs_frag */
67: #if NOTDEF /* what follows isn't interesting */
68: /* this data must be re-computed after crashes */
69: struct csum fs_cstotal; /* cylinder summary information */
70: /* these fields are cleared at mount time */
71: char fs_fmod; /* super block modified flag */
72: char fs_clean; /* file system is clean flag */
73: char fs_ronly; /* mounted read-only flag */
74: char fs_flags; /* currently unused flag */
75: char fs_fsmnt[MAXMNTLEN]; /* name mounted on */
76: /* these fields retain the current block allocation info */
77: long fs_cgrotor; /* last cg searched */
78: struct csum *fs_csp[MAXCSBUFS];/* list of fs_cs info buffers */
79: long fs_cpc; /* cyl per cycle in postbl */
80: short fs_postbl[MAXCPG][NRPOS];/* head of blocks for each rotation */
81: long fs_magic; /* magic number */
82: u_char fs_rotbl[1]; /* list of blocks for each rotation */
83: /* actually longer */
84: #endif
85: };
86:
87: #define INOSIZE 128 /* length of inode on disk */
88:
89: #define NDADDR 12
90: #define NIADDR 3
91:
92: /*
93: * inode on disk
94: */
95:
96: struct icommon
97: {
98: short i_mode; /* 0: mode and type of file */
99: short i_nlink; /* 2: number of links to file */
100: short i_uid; /* 4: owner's user id */
101: short i_gid; /* 6: owner's group id */
102: long i_size; /* 8: number of bytes in file */
103: long i_hisize; /* 12: high part of 64-byte size */
104: long i_atime; /* 16: time last accessed */
105: long i_atspare;
106: long i_mtime; /* 24: time last modified */
107: long i_mtspare;
108: long i_ctime; /* 32: last time inode changed */
109: long i_ctspare;
110: long i_db[NDADDR]; /* 40: disk block addresses */
111: long i_ib[NIADDR]; /* 88: indirect blocks */
112: long i_flags; /* 100: status, currently unused */
113: long i_blocks; /* 104: blocks actually held */
114: long i_spare[5]; /* 108: reserved, currently unused */
115: };
116:
117: #define ROOTINO 2
118:
119: /*
120: * directory format
121: */
122:
123: #define MAXNAMLEN 255
124:
125: struct direct {
126: long d_ino; /* inode number of entry */
127: unsigned short d_reclen; /* length of this record */
128: unsigned short d_namlen; /* length of string in d_name */
129: char d_name[MAXNAMLEN + 1]; /* name must be no longer than this */
130: };
131:
132: #define DIRSIZ(dp) \
133: ((sizeof (struct direct) - (MAXNAMLEN+1)) + (((dp)->d_namlen+1 + 3) &~ 3))
